Principal Control Command and Communications Engineer
The post-holder will provide competent and timely professional and technical expertise necessary to support RSSB’s delivery of standards projects that form part of the Control, Command Signalling Standards Committee (CCS SC) Strategy, covering new and existing control, command signalling (CCS) technologies.
This requires the post-holder to:
- Lead and work with relevant engineering and operational specialists to develop CCS requirements, rationale and guidance in the context of the railway system covering CCS technical systems
- Lead and support the application of appropriate requirements capture techniques
- Facilitate industry consensus on emerging requirements, rationale and guidance.
- Author new and revised standards in accordance with the Standards Code and Manual and RSSB style guides, including Railway Group Standards and non-mandatory standards produced by RSSB, together with TSIs and ENs (to the extent that RSSB has a mandate to support their development)
- Support delivery of industry projects, including RSSB research, covering new and existing CCS technologies
- Provide specialist support within the CCC discipline for accreditation services provided by RSSB to the United Kingdom Accreditation Service.
Responsibilities
- Deliver CCS requirements, rationale and guidance that are complete, accurate, well written and compliant with the standards code and manual.
- Provide timely and comprehensive technical support to help RSSB deliver research and innovation.
- Provide timely and comprehensive technical support to RSSB members in line with reasonable requests.
- Influence an improved level of understanding within RSSB and across the wider industry of the role of requirements in supporting the achievement of technical compatibility and safe integration.
- Represent RSSB through membership of relevant industry committees, including technical committees and mirror groups facilitated by RSSB and others. Chair industry meetings as required.
- Identify opportunities for and implement improved methodologies for developing requirements and research.
- Work in conjunction with Standards Policy department to ensure that the solutions developed, or documents drafted, comply with the relevant decision-making criteria for the environment in which they are made.
- Provide direction, advice and coaching to develop direct reports. Resolve technical issues for matters escalated by direct reports.
- Report progress and provide technical direction and advice to project managers and the Professional Head of CCC on progress made on individual projects.
- Act as Professional Head of CCC on an interim basis as required.
- Ensure that the means of achieving improvements (for example safety, technical and/or economic) are sought through the identification of technical opportunities and by monitoring technical development and international best practise.
Qualifications
- Educated to degree level or equivalent relevant experience.
- A chartered engineer with substantial experience in a senior role within the rail industry
- A Member of the Institution of Railway Signalling Engineers or similar, working towards being a Fellow of the Institution.
- A comprehensive level of experience in Railway Command, Control and Signalling Systems
- A broad understanding of the legal and regulatory framework in which RSSB operates, including the Railways Interoperability Directive, Technical Specification for Interoperability for CCS, the Railways and Other Guided Transport Systems (Safety) Regulations and the Railway Group Standards Code and Standards Manual
- Excellent communication skills including strong presentation skills
- The ability to understand technical documents
- Excellent facilitation skills and the ability to influence and negotiate and collaborate with senior stakeholders at all levels to explain the results of work
- Good analytical skills with the ability to assimilate information and abstract ideas.
